GP on Joystiq - Prez Candidate on Second Life: Smart Move or Political Suicide?
This week's The Political Game examines the long-term political fallout from presidential hopeful Mark Warner's recent campaign stop on Second Life.
Will it help position him as a tech-savvy and youthful candidate? Or will political opponents turn his Second Life visit against him? Should politicians dabble in the gaming realm at all?

Speaking of SL, publisher Linden Lab revealed a major hack attack this week in which user info and credit card data was stolen. That's especially annoying to GP, who just signed up for SL on Monday in order to cover Gov. Warner's next event, scheduled for later this year.
